Skip to content

Commit 3040c55

Browse files
committed
Add syntax hovers for oxcaml
1 parent 79864a6 commit 3040c55

File tree

8 files changed

+1293
-132
lines changed

8 files changed

+1293
-132
lines changed

src/analysis/completion.ml

Lines changed: 9 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-133,6 +133,15 @@ let classify_node = function
133133
| Open_declaration _ -> `Module
134134
| Include_declaration _ -> `Module
135135
| Include_description _ -> `Module
136+
| Mode _ | Modality _ ->
137+
(* CR-someday: Have proper completion for modes and modalities *)
138+
`Expression
139+
| Jkind_annotation _ ->
140+
(* CR-someday: Have proper completion for jkinds *)
141+
`Type
142+
| Attribute _ ->
143+
(* CR-someday: Have proper completion for attributes *)
144+
`Expression
136145

137146
open Query_protocol.Compl
138147

0 commit comments

Comments
 (0)